Re: Please tell me about singlespeeds

I built a 2014 Fargo as a SS flat bar with Fox forks and love it. Nice thing is that the 2014 frame has alternator dropouts, so SS is easy, as is Rohloff, Alfine or gears. I like the fact that it has a properly designed set of dropouts for Rohloff, not a bodge. So it would be well worth considering ...
